About 60 residents were forced to flee their tower block in their nightclothes early this morning (Thursday) after a fire broke out on the tenth floor.

Six fire engines and 30 firefighters tackled the blaze in the 15-storey block in Belsham Street, Homerton, from 6.30am until just before 8am, but many of the residents had already evacuated the building before they arrived.

An ambulance crew treated a child and two adults for smoke inhalation at the scene, while fire crews from Kingsland, Homerton, Bethnal Green and Stoke Newington worked to extinguish the flames.

The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
